#mySQL

mysql重置root密码

1、在配置文件my.ini最后增加:skip-grant-tables2、重启mysql服务:netstopmysqlnetstartmysql3、无密码进入数据库,重置密码为root:mysql-uroot-pusemysqlupdateusersetpassword=PASSWORD("root")whereuse...
代码星球 ·2020-08-09

Mysql设置允许外网访问(图文)

 1、打开mysql.exe(MySQLCommandLineClient),输入密码2、输入:usemysql;3、查询host输入:selectuser,hostfromuser;4、创建host(如果有"%"这个host值,则跳过这一步)如果没有"%"这个host值,就执行下面这两句:mysql>...

mysql随机抽取数据

 --慢SELECT*FROMtable_nameORDERBYrand()LIMIT5;--较慢SELECT*FROM`table`WHEREid>=(SELECTfloor(RAND()*((SELECTMAX(id)FROM`table`)-(SELECTMIN(id)FROM`table`))+...
代码星球 ·2020-08-09

MySQL:Specified key was too long; max key length is 767 bytes.

建表语句:CREATETABLEIFNotEXISTSapi(apivarchar(500)notnull,methodvarchar(50)notnulldefault'POST',PRIMARYkey(api,method))ENGINE=InnoDBDEFAULTCHARSET=utf8;报错: Spe...
代码星球 ·2020-08-09

Grafana+Prometheus 监控 MySQL

架构图环境IP环境需装软件192.168.0.237mysql-5.7.20node_exporter-0.15.2.linux-amd64.tar.gzmysqld_exporter-0.10.0.linux-amd64.tar.gz192.168.0.248grafana+prometheusprometheus-...
代码星球 ·2020-08-09

Python 使用 PyMysql、DBUtils 创建连接池,提升性能

Python编程中可以使用PyMysql进行数据库的连接及诸如查询/插入/更新等操作,但是每次连接MySQL数据库请求时,都是独立的去请求访问,相当浪费资源,而且访问数量达到一定数量时,对mysql的性能会产生较大的影响。因此,实际使用中,通常会使用数据库的连接池技术,来访问数据库达到资源复用的目的。DBUtils是一...

mysql只显示表名和备注

查看某个数据下的表及其备注:selecttable_name,table_commentfrominformation_schema.tableswheretable_schema='db';只要改后面的table_schema为你的数据库名结果: 查看某个表下的字段及其备注desc表名;showcolumn...
代码星球 ·2020-08-09

Mysql 报错:#1067

由于字段UPDATE_TIME的字段类型是timestamp,默认值是:'0000-00-0000:00:00'即:`UPDATE_TIME`timestampNOTNULLDEFAULT'0000-00-0000:00:00'COMMENT'更新时间';在对这个表进行创建的时候,提示:#1067-Invaliddef...
代码星球 ·2020-08-09

ubuntu19 安装mysql8.0.17 后重新设置root密码

mysql版本: 终端输入:sudocat/etc/mysql/debian.cnf显示内容:#AutomaticallygeneratedforDebianscripts.DONOTTOUCH![client]host=localhostuser=debian-sys-maintpassword=PGBiN...

Ubuntu移除mysql后重新安装

首先删除mysql:sudoaptpurgemysql-servermysql-clientmysql-commonsudoaptautoremovesudomv-iv/var/lib/mysql/var/tmp/mysql-backupsudorm-rf/var/lib/mysql*然后清理残留的数据dpkg-l|g...

mysql安装出现问题(The service already exists)

1.管理员身份运行cmd(系统win10)2.输入命令cd/dF:mysql-5.7.19-win32in(此为mysql要安装的目录)3.输入安装命令mysqldinstall出现问题Theservicealreadyexists这是由于之前已经安装过mysql并且没有删除干净4.重新以管理员身份运行,输入scqu...

MySQL的常用命令

1.修改mysql的密码:mysqladmin-uusername-poldpasswordpassword之后输入新密码验证就可以了;2.显示所有的数据库showdatabases;3.选择数据库usemysql4.查看当前选择的数据库selectdatabase();5.查看当前mysql的版本selectvers...
代码星球 ·2020-08-09

【Hadoop离线基础总结】Hue与Mysql集成

1.修改hue.ini配置文件这里要去掉#,打开mysql注释,大概在1547行[[[mysql]]]nice_name="MySQLDB"engine=mysqlhost=node03.hadoop.comport=3306user=rootpassword=1234562.启动hue进程,查看Hive是否与Mysq...

【不断更新】mysql经典50道题自我练习

测试数据和练习题均转载自CSDN博主@启明星的指引的文章sql语句练习50题(Mysql版),用于mysql的每日自我练习表名和字段–1.学生表Student(s_id,s_name,s_birth,s_sex)--学生编号,学生姓名,出生年月,学生性别–2.课程表Course(c_id,c_name,t_id)–--...

【MySQL基础总结】索引的使用

索引的使用概述1.索引由数据库中一列或多列组合而成,其作用是提高对表中数据的查询速度2.索引的优点是可以提高检索数据的速度3.缺点是创建和维护索引需要耗费时间4.所以索引可以提高查询速度,减慢写入速度分类1.普通索引2.唯一索引(UNIQUEKEY就属于唯一索引)3.全文索引(通过FULLTEXT,只能在CHAR/VA...
首页上一页...443444445446447...下一页尾页